Output 82fa0fbd42128c60b02e172c98a454c4052ccec4aa6b310a82085be2db1ae98d:0

value
413438
script pubkey
OP_0 OP_PUSHBYTES_20 de45834478e99fb26464bdc3c5ad1640a75c7d9f
address
bc1qmezcx3rcax0myeryhhputtgkgzn4clvlqch3lw
transaction
82fa0fbd42128c60b02e172c98a454c4052ccec4aa6b310a82085be2db1ae98d
confirmations
186057
spent
true